A balsa wood glider gains lift primarily through its wings, which are designed with an airfoil shape. As the glider moves through the air, the wings create a difference in air pressure; the air moves faster over the curved upper surface than the flatter lower surface, resulting in lower pressure above the wing and higher pressure below. This pressure difference generates lift, allowing the glider to rise and stay aloft. Additionally, the angle of attack, or the tilt of the wings relative to the airflow, can enhance lift up to a certain point before causing drag or stalling.
